Redis让数据存储变得更简单(redis过程)

Redis是一种开源的键值(key-value)存储系统,它的高性能和高可用性使其成为多种数据存储解决方案中的一种。它既可以作为一个单独的服务运行,也可以用作缓存服务器或者数据库服务器去存储数据。Redis提供了许多有用的特性,使它成为用于在构建高可扩展系统的首选方案,这些特性使Redis成为存储数据的最佳选择。

Redis支持多样化的数据类型,这使开发人员可以选择不同的数据类型以存储和检索数据。例如,开发人员可以使用字符串,哈希,列表,集合和有序集合等数据类型存储数据。这一点使用户可以根据自己的需求对数据进行组织,而不用拘泥于特定的结构。

Redis使数据存储更加便捷。它拥有一系列快速的读写命令,使开发人员可以快速存取数据,这些命令又分为单个和批量操作的读写命令,并且支持其他常用的读写方法,如Pipeiilne,Pub/Sub,Lua脚本等。

另外,Redis还支持缓存技术。开发人员可以使用定制的LRU(Least Recently Used)缓存策略缓存数据,这使得开发人员可以让数据在发生变动时自动刷新缓存,同时如果缓存空间不足,Redis能够自动淘汰最少使用的缓存。

此外,Redis还提供了一些复制和持久性功能,这使得开发者可以非常容易地将数据进行持久化,或者将数据从一个服务器复制到另一个服务器,这一点大大提高了系统的容错性和可扩展性。

Redis是一个强大的数据存储工具,它使数据存储变得更加简单,便捷,高效,可扩展,安全。Redis因其广泛应用于诸如分布式缓存,消息队列,排行榜,日志系统,实时分析等领域而广受欢迎,它有可能被用于各种数据存储需求中。


数据运维技术 » Redis让数据存储变得更简单(redis过程)